redis.windows-service.conf和redis.windows.conf的区别

本文探讨了Windows环境下Redis的两个关键配置文件redis.windows-service.conf和redis.windows.conf的区别,以及如何切换到后者。重点在于Windows服务配置和手动启动配置文件的使用技巧。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

redis.windows-service.conf和redis.windows.conf的区别

redis的windows版本的安装目录下有两个配置文件:
①redis.windows-service.conf
②redis.windows.conf

直接点击安装目录下的redis-server.exe会默认加载redis.windows-service.conf的配置。
因此想要加载redis.windows.conf的配置,只需在安装目录下运行控制台,输入redis-server redis.windows.conf即可。

### Redis 配置文件对比 #### redis.windows.conf 文件 此配置文件主要用于以常规方式启动 Redis 实例。当通过命令行直接运行 `redis-server` 并指定该配置文件时,会按照其中设定的各项参数来初始化服务[^2]。 对于希望在开发环境中快速测试或调试应用来说非常方便,因为它允许开发者即时调整设置而无需重启整个系统服务[^5]。 ```bash D:\soft\Redis>redis-server redis.windows.conf --loglevel notice ``` #### redis.windows-service.conf 文件 相比之下,`redis.windows-service.conf` 是专门为作为 Windows 服务安装管理设计的配置文件。这意味着它包含了更适合长期稳定运行于生产环境下的默认选项集合[^4]。 例如,默认情况下可能会禁用某些危险操作(如 FLUSHALL),并启用持久化机制等特性,从而保障数据安全性可靠性。此外,使用此配置文件可以更轻松地实现自动开机自启等功能[^3]。 ```bash D:\soft\Redis>redis-server --service-install redis.windows-service.conf --loglevel verbose ``` 两个配置文件的主要区别在于它们的应用场景不同: - **应用场景** - `redis.windows.conf`: 更适合用于临时性的本地测试或是不需要长时间持续在线的服务部署。 - `redis.windows-service.conf`: 则更加侧重于满足企业级需求,在服务器上作为一个后台进程不间断工作,并且能够更好地融入到Windows操作系统的服务管理体系之中。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

头盔程序员

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值